EPREM (20181001)

Energetic Particle Radiation Environment Module

Model Description

At CCMC EPREM can be run in three ways:
1) EPREM: assuming a Parker Spiral IMF, background conditions.
2) EPREM+Cone: assuming a Parker Spiral IMF, with an inserted idealized "cone" CME into the EPREM domain.
3) EPREM+ENLIL: uses a WSA-ENLIL+Cone run as it's domain.  For this option, first an WSA-ENLIL+Cone simulation with appropriate settings must be selected from the run database.
